In a surprising yet exciting development, Valve has introduced a new update for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) that brings a unique collaboration with Paramount Games. The update celebrates the release of 'Jackass: Best and Last' by adding a special Jackass Sticker Capsule to the game. This move showcases Valve's willingness to experiment and bring unexpected elements into the world of CS2, which is a refreshing change from the typical gaming updates we see.
A Sticker Celebration
The Jackass Sticker Capsule is a treasure trove for fans of the iconic stunt show. It introduces 39 new stickers, each paying homage to memorable moments from the Jackass franchise. From the Poo Cocktail Supreme to other iconic pranks, these stickers are sure to add a touch of humor and nostalgia to players' CS2 experience. The inclusion of lenticular stickers, which create a 3D effect, adds an extra layer of excitement and innovation to the collection.
